In sh3 one of my favorite things was not to use the button bar on the bottom of the screen but to navigate through the virtual bridge whenever I had to go to a station. For me this really added to the atmosphere. Can you still do that or is there a mod to do it. The only ppl I seem to be able to access through the virtual bridge are the sonar and radar guys. I just want to make sour I am not missing something.

you can click on the helmsman and assume his position. you can also click on the control room hatch to take you to the conning tower and from there the hatch to the bridge. while in the coning tower click the raise periscope button then click on the edge of the scope and you'll be right in front of it, then click the lens and that'll be your view thru the scope. clicking the sonarman assumes his position as well
